Float, a Toronto based corporate card and expense management platform, raised $70m, led by Goldman Sachs, with participation from OMERS, FJ Labs, Garage Capital and Teralys.
Ownwell, a Vancouver based marketing automation tool for mortgage brokers, raised an undisclosed pre-seed led by Conconi Growth Partners.
Gumloop, a Vancouver based tool that automates tasks like processing email invoices and contacting recruits on Linkedin, raised USD $17m from Nexus Venture Partners, YC, and First Round Capital.
Vasco, a Montreal based sales & marketing analytics platform for b2b software companies raised USD $6m from Inovia, Framework & BY Venture Partners.
Sellit9, a platform for shoppers to trade-in their old products in exchange for cash, raised $1.5m from Drive Capital and Northside Ventures.
Borderless, a Toronto based HR platform for companies to hire international employees, raised $5m from the co-founders of Cohere, a Toronto based AI LLM company.
QuoteMachine, a Montreal based platform for merchants to manage quotes, orders, inventory and payments was acquired by Lightspeed, a Montreal based payments company.
Blade Labs, Toronto based company which provides staking infrastructure for Solana was acquired by WonderFi, a crypto exchange.
Bench, a Vancouver based bookkeeping startup that was acquired by Employer.com after abruptly shutting down last month, had $94m in debt and only $4m in cash.

Ratehub, a Toronto based mortgage comparison site, expanded into consumer loans.
Ratehub also owns its own mortgage lending business called CanWise. I’m curious to see if they’ll launch a similar personal lending business now.
Ratehub was acquired by Novacap, a Toronto based private equity group in 2022.
Ribbon, a Toronto based back office platform to register and manage small businesses launched features for tax filing / tracking & for employee reimbursements.
Sagard, a Montreal based alternative investment firm, launched a private fund for retail investors.
Venturevest, an alternative investment marketplace for retail investors launched in Montreal.
Transcard, a US b2b payments company has expanded into Canada.
BMO Capital Markets is paying a USD $40m settlement over SEC allegations that it misled investors about the construction of its mortgage-backed securities from 2020 to 2023.
CCI, a trade group for Canadian tech companies launched a think tank called Canadian Shield, to produce policy research on Canadian “economic nationalism” like national security, tax policy, and promoting homegrown innovation.
TD’s CEO is stepping down two months earlier than previously announced, following the bank’s guilty plea to a drug money laundering scandal thatresulted in a USD $3b fine.
